Why Pull Up Banner Prices Differ in Singapore
Two businesses can pay S$95 and S$272 for what appears to be the same 85cm banner — and both can be making exactly the right decision. The price difference is not arbitrary. It reflects three concrete variables.
Base mechanism quality. The spring cassette inside the aluminium base is the component most subject to wear. The Budget Series is rated for 5–8 exhibition cycles. The Deluxe Series is rated for 15–20+ exhibition cycles, with the aluminium frame itself built for 20+ years of use.
Graphic substrate. Budget Series banners use standard PVC vinyl. Premium and Deluxe Series banners use tear-proof synthetic paper — dimensionally stable, resistant to creasing along roll lines, and built to handle Singapore's humidity-driven condensation cycles without warping over time.
Lamination type. Budget Series ships with standard lamination. Premium and Deluxe Series include matte anti-glare lamination — the correct choice for Singapore's exhibition venues, where high-intensity LED overhead lighting creates direct glare on gloss-laminated surfaces that makes them unreadable from standard approach angles.
Understanding these three variables makes the right price point clear before you ever place an order.

Why matte lamination matters in Singapore: Singapore Expo, Suntec City, and indoor mall atriums use high-intensity LED overhead lighting. Gloss-laminated banners reflect this light directly toward approaching visitors, making them difficult to read from the angles typical of exhibition and roadshow foot traffic. Matte lamination eliminates this problem entirely — and for any banner deployed at an indoor Singapore venue, it is the practical choice rather than a preference.

Why zero-ripple matters beyond aesthetics: Designs using large photographic backgrounds, gradient colour fills, or light pastel palettes make any surface tension inconsistency immediately visible. More importantly, every trade show and corporate event generates official photography — and a rippled or bowed banner surface reproduces clearly in event photos, undermining the brand presentation it was designed to support. The Deluxe Series ensures the banner looks exactly as designed in every venue, under every lighting condition, and in every photograph.

Graphic Replacement: Reprint Without Buying a New Stand
When your brand changes or a campaign ends, replacing only the graphic costs significantly less than purchasing a new unit. Pullupstand.com's graphic replacement service costs 40–60% less than a full new stand. For pop up display systems, the Pop Up Panel Reprint service starts from S$1,100 — refreshing the graphics while retaining the aluminium frame that represents the majority of the system's value.
Reprint the graphic if:
-
The retraction mechanism extends and retracts smoothly with no resistance or irregular motion
-
The graphic surface lies flat when fully extended, with no permanent bowing or warping
-
The base sits level and stable on standard flooring
-
The carry case still provides adequate impact protection during transport
Purchase a new unit if:
-
The mechanism is stiff, catches, or retracts unevenly — a faulty cassette will damage a new graphic within the first few deployments
-
The base wobbles or tilts during deployment
-
You are upgrading tiers for a more demanding venue or higher event frequency
